Z-Image-Turbo is a next‑generation AI image generation model designed for **ultra‑fast inference** while preserving **high visual fidelity**. It leverages a novel **spatially‑adaptive denoising** architecture that reduces computational overhead by up to 70% compared to previous models. The model supports native resolutions up to **4K** and can generate a full‑frame image in under **200 ms** on a single GPU. Integration with popular pipelines is streamlined through a unified API that accepts text prompts, style references, and control nets.
